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service Mount Holly NJ
239 PM EDT Mon Jul 6 2020

The National Weather Service in Mount Holly NJ has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  Northern Atlantic County in southern New Jersey...
  Central Ocean County in southern New Jersey...
  Camden County in southern New Jersey...
  Gloucester County in southern New Jersey...
  Burlington County in southern New Jersey...
  Southeastern Montgomery County in southeastern Pennsylvania...
  Southeastern Bucks County in southeastern Pennsylvania...
  Philadelphia County in southeastern Pennsylvania...

* Until 345 PM EDT.

* At 239 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Palmyra, or
  near Philadelphia, moving southeast at 15 mph.

  H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...Minor damage to vehicles is possible. Wind damage to
           roofs, siding, trees, and power lines is possible.

* Locations impacted include...
  Philadelphia, Camden, Gloucester City, Cherry Hill, Bensalem,
  Evesham, Mount Laurel, Willingboro, Deptford, Voorhees, Medford,
  West Deptford, Barnegat, Glassboro, Lindenwold, Hammonton,
  Lumberton, Florence, Bellmawr and Yeadon.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.

In addition to large hail and damaging winds, frequent cloud to
ground lightning is occurring with this storm. Move indoors
immediately. Remember, if you can hear thunder, you are close enough
to be struck by lightning.
